Alright, let's switch gears and talk about the Texas Supreme Court. This is the highest state court in Texas, and it's responsible for interpreting the laws and constitution of the state. The decisions made by the Texas Supreme Court can have a significant impact on the lives of Texans, so it's important to stay informed about what's going on in the court. Some of the areas the court often deals with include civil matters, appeals from lower courts, and interpreting state laws.

The Attorney General is the chief legal officer of the state and is responsible for representing Texas in legal matters. The Attorney General also plays a key role in enforcing state laws and protecting the interests of Texans. Often, the office tackles consumer protection, antitrust, and criminal justice issues.
